Jurisdiction and Background
1. This Court has jurisdiction over this Application pursuant to 28 U.S.C. §§ 1334 and 157.
Venue in this Court is proper p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 1409. This Application is a core proceeding within
the meaning of 28 U.S.C. § 157.
2. The statutory bases for the relief requested herein are sections 330 and 331 of the
Bankruptcy Code, Bankruptcy Rule 2016 and Local Rule 2016-1.
3. The Committee retained Dundon as its financial advisor shortly after its formation on
February 3, 2021. On March 24, 2021, the Court entered the Retention Order.
Prior Fees and Expenses
4. Pursuant to the terms of the Interim Compensation Order, Dundon filed one (1) combined
monthly fee statement on April 21, 2021 covering the period of February 4, 2021 through March 31, 2021
for services rendered and expenses incurred [Docket No. 414] requesting approval of $96,670.00 in fees
and $0.00 in expenses (“Combined Monthly Fee Statement”). Dundon has received payment of 80% of

Services Provided
6. During the Final Fee Period, Dundon provided analysis and monitoring of the case budget
and variances thereto providing the Committee and its professionals with information and status of the
case. In addition, Dundon performed a detailed analysis of the various claims pools and the proposed go-
forward business plan and provided essential information that supported the Committee and its
professionals in their negotiations with the Debtors and the various interested parties that resulted in the
very favorable outcome of the unsecured creditors being paid in full or fully assumed by the reorganized
entity.
7. The services rendered by Dundon can be grouped into the categories set forth below.
Dundon attempted to place the services provided in the category that best relates to such services.
However, because certain services may relate to one or more categories, services pertaining to one
category may in fact be included in another category. These services performed, by categories are
generally described below, with a more detailed explanation set forth in the attached Exhibits F and G.
A. Business Analysis
8. Time billed to this category relates to the Debtors’ business and budgets. During the Final

Fee Period, Dundon, among other things: (i) reviewed and analyzed the Debtors’ budgets and variance
reports; (ii) reviewed and analyzed the Debtors monthly operating reports; (iii) assisted on the preparation
of an objection to the cash collateral order; and (iv) communicated with Committee members and other
committee professionals regarding the foregoing.
Fees: $19,950.00 Hours: 31.0
B. Case Administration
9. This category relates to work regarding administration of this case. During the Final Fee
Period, Dundon, among other things, (i) reviewed correspondence and motions; (ii) participated in general
status calls with E&Y; (iii) attended hearings; and (iv) prepared diligence and related analysis.
Fees: $25,220.00 Hours: 51.4
C. Claim Analysis
10. Time billed to this category relates to the review and analysis of claims against the Debtors’
estates. During the Final Fee Period, Dundon, among other things: (i) performed a review and analysis of
secured, administrative and priority claims asserted against the estates; (ii) reviewed information from the
Debtors’ advisors regarding rejection damages; (iii) reviewed and analyzed the general unsecured claims
pool; and (iv) analyzed the SOFAs and SOALs.
Fees: $14,225.00 Hours: 23.9
D. Committee Activities
11. This category relates primarily to communications with the Committee and Committee
Counsel regarding the various filings and strategies of the case. During the Final Fee Period, Dundon,
among other things: (i) prepared presentations for the Committee on the business, budget variances and
the bankruptcy process; (ii) participated in weekly status calls with the Committee and its professionals;
and (iii) communicated with Committee members, Committee counsel and Debtor’s professionals.
Fees: $27,125.00 Hours: 47.2

Basis for Relief
15. Section 330 of the Bankruptcy Code provides for compensation of professionals and
provides that a court may award a professional employed under section 327 of the Bankruptcy Code,
“reasonable compensation for actual necessary services rendered . . . and reimbursement for actual,
necessary expenses.” 11 U.S.C. § 330(a)(1).
